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Delaware to Clarksville is to drive which costs $140 - $220 and takes 13h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Delaware to Clarksville is to fly and bus which takes 6h 50m and costs $140 - $550.
The distance between Delaware and Clarksville is 768 miles. The road distance is 805.6 miles.
The best way to get from Delaware to Clarksville without a car is to train and bus via Roanoke which takes 19h 5m and costs $150 - $1,100.
It takes approximately 7h 17m to get from Delaware to Clarksville, including transfers.
Clarksville is 1h behind Delaware. It is currently 6:44 PM in Delaware and 5:44 PM in Clarksville.
Yes, the driving distance between Delaware to Clarksville is 806 miles. It takes approximately 13h 55m to drive from Delaware to Clarksville.
